Truckee grew up as a railroad town, and it still looks like one. The Central Pacific's transcontinental line came through here in 1868, and Commercial Row downtown — false-front wood buildings now holding restaurants and outfitters — dates to not long after. Donner Pass and Donner Summit sit just west of town, marked by old snow sheds and the history of the 1846 Donner Party; Donner Lake itself, with a swimmable beach and lakeside camping, is a five-minute drive from downtown. Tahoe Donner, a large residential and resort area above town, holds a cluster of cabins alongside its own small ski hill and golf course.

Truckee works as a base precisely because it isn't lakefront — cabin and tiny-home rates run lower than shoreline towns, and Reno-Tahoe International Airport is about 35 to 40 minutes away via I-80. Winters bring serious snow (chains are often required during storms), and Northstar, Palisades Tahoe, and Sugar Bowl are all within a 20-minute drive.

Good to know

Do I need chains in winter to drive to Truckee?

Often, yes, during storms. Caltrans posts chain requirements for I-80 and Highway 89 in real time; carrying chains from November through April is standard practice even with four-wheel drive.

How far is Truckee from Reno airport?

About 35 to 40 minutes via I-80, roughly 35 miles. It's the closest major airport to this side of Lake Tahoe.

Is Truckee part of Lake Tahoe?

Not directly on the lake — Truckee sits about 15 minutes north of Tahoe City. It's a common base for visiting the whole Tahoe area plus Donner Lake, with generally lower lodging rates than lakefront towns.
